Norma Jean Brooks, 72, of Pittsburg, KS, passed away at 2:00 a.m., Wednesday, March 6, 2013, at Via Christi Hospital, after a courageous battle with cancer.

She was born on May 5, 1940 at Pittsburg, KS, the daughter of Ellis and Marguerite Fossman. She attended Pittsburg Schools and graduated from Pittsburg High School.

On July 20, 1957, she was united in marriage to Bobbie Brooks at Miami, OK, he survives of the home.

Mrs. Brooks worked for Mulberry Limestone, Parsons Ammunition Plant, and Dollar General.
Membership was held at Grace United Methodist Church.

Survivors include her husband, Bob, of the home; two sons, Dennis Brooks and his wife Laurie of Pittsburg, KS, and Richard Brooks and his wife Tami of Olathe, KS; three sisters, Colleen Fossman of Waskom, TX, Connie Baker of Waskom, TX, and Barbara Tustin of Pittsburg, KS; three grandchildren Bobby Brooks of Pittsburg, KS, Jessica Brooks of Olathe, KS, and Jenni Brooks of Olathe, KS; two great-grandchildren, Ethan Brooks and Trinity Brooks.

She was preceded in death by her parents, a brother, Rickey Fossman, and a great-grandson, Kylor Brooks.
